Output 26cdc0bfcb8764c8d03ae9bb64d85d68e8c200f784d31b795691b39a5e63199a:0

value
36509421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e477922f5953e9f23c5091e9a37e7a8690eea027 OP_EQUAL
address
3NX3EDqtzHfW3xM8PotgNHmU4kVpNnwp7B
transaction
26cdc0bfcb8764c8d03ae9bb64d85d68e8c200f784d31b795691b39a5e63199a
spent
true